环境: vue3 , visual studio code, bulma
背景: 在代码中,使用标签来进行导航栏跳转。
如:
<div class="navbar-start"><a href="/groups">产品</router-link>
</div>
执行:
npm run dev
在开发环境,能正常进行跳转。
但是编译后, npm run build
, 放到 web服务器上后,不能正常跳转,console提示:
crbug/1173575 non-js module files deprecated
网上资料说是修改: vscode的launch.json。 对不起,我没用vs code 的live插件,根本不存在 .vscode 下不存在launch.json文件。
解决办法:
使用router-link:
<div class="navbar-start"><router-link class="navbar-item" :to="{ name: 'Groups'}">产品</router-link></div>